Course structure

• Introduction to Environmental Communication
• Media and Environmental Reporting
• Climate Change Communication Strategies
• Environmental Data Visualization
• Storytelling for Environmental Issues
• Ethics in Environmental Journalism
• Digital Tools for Environmental Reporting
• Public Engagement and Advocacy
• Environmental Policy and Communication
• Case Studies in Environmental Reporting

Career path

```html Career Roles for Executive Certificate in Environmental Communication Reporting

career roles for executive certificate in environmental communication reporting

career role key responsibilities
environmental journalist research, write, and report on environmental issues
sustainability communications specialist develop and implement sustainability communication strategies
corporate social responsibility (csr) reporter document and communicate csr initiatives and impacts
environmental policy communicator translate policy updates into accessible content for stakeholders
climate change communication officer create awareness campaigns and educational materials on climate change
environmental data analyst and reporter analyze environmental data and present findings through reports
public relations specialist for environmental organizations manage public image and media relations for environmental causes
